Common Circuit Breaker Replacement Jobs
Circuit breaker replacement involves upgrading outdated or damaged breakers to ensure reliable electrical protection.
Main breaker replacement helps restore proper power distribution and prevents overloads in the home.
Subpanel breaker replacement allows for additional circuits and improved electrical capacity in specific areas.
Emergency breaker replacement addresses sudden breaker trips or failure to restore power safely.
GFCI breaker replacement enhances safety in areas prone to moisture, such as kitchens and bathrooms.
Arc fault breaker replacement reduces the risk of electrical fires by detecting and disconnecting faulty circuits.
Circuit Breaker Replacement Questions
What is a circuit breaker replacement? It involves removing a faulty breaker and installing a new one to ensure proper electrical safety and functionality.
When should a circuit breaker be replaced? Replacement is recommended if the breaker trips frequently, shows signs of damage, or does not reset properly.
What types of projects typically require circuit breaker replacement? Projects include upgrading electrical systems, repairing electrical panels, or replacing outdated or damaged breakers.
What should property owners know before requesting a replacement? Proper assessment of the electrical panel is important to determine if a replacement is needed and to ensure compatibility with existing wiring.
